Helped in saving efforts initially, then, with time, the intelligence kicked in post-integration with our various monitoring tools. This minimized the alerts coming to the Command Center Team. Enabled automation on key technology across the landscape supported.

The sales team lagged the technical depth .We escalated and the implementation team on the ground was savvy making it easy for us to decide.
The professional services team was excellent and had the patience to handle numerous questions and concerns.
Be clear that you need to invest in some additional funds prior to kick-starting AIops for change management.
